Thibaut Courtois sends message to Chelsea fans ahead of Champions League showdown


Thibaut Courtois has been speaking about the Chelsea faithful ahead of their encounter with his Real Madrid side on Wednesday evening.

The two European powerhouses, who met in the semi-finals of last season’s competition, go head-to-head at Stamford Bridge later today.

Ahead of the tie Courtois, who spent a number of years on Chelsea’s books and made over 120 appearances for them, has urged the Blues faithful not to boo him:

"I hope that they (supporters) don't boo me, but you never know,” he said.

"I hope it's a happy return to Stamford Bridge. We're now rivals. They'll want to win and the same goes for me. "So I'm not expecting any applause from the fans."

Chelsea vs Real Madrid

Chelsea head into the Real Madrid game on the back of a pretty concerning 4-1 loss at the hands of Brentford.

Despite this major upset, Thomas Tuchel is still likely confident of getting one over on Madrid this week and next week.

The German would beat Real with Chelsea in the semi-finals of last season’s Champions League, with the Blues of course going on to win the competition.

And before that, Tuchel was already unbeaten against the Spanish powerhouse when in charge of both Borussia Dortmund and PSG:
